Liquid cargo ships, commonly known as "tankers," are vessels specifically designed to transport liquid commodities in bulk. As an essential component of maritime trade, they carry diverse liquids including crude oil, petroleum products, chemicals, and liquefied natural gas (LNG). Classification depends on both cargo type and vessel size.

Engineered with specialized coatings and containment systems to safely handle diverse chemical properties. Feature multiple segregated tanks to prevent cross-contamination.
Highly specialized vessels transporting liquefied natural gas at cryogenic temperatures (-162°C). Require advanced containment systems and dedicated port infrastructure.
